Understanding the Core Mechanics of Crash Aviator
At its heart, a crash aviator game presents a deceptively simple premise. A virtual airplane takes off and ascends on a gradually increasing multiplier. Players place a bet before each round, hoping to cash out their wager before the plane ‘crashes’. The longer the plane flies, the higher the multiplier—and consequently, the larger the potential payout. However, the risk is equally significant; if the plane crashes before you cash out, you lose your entire bet. This element of risk and reward creates an intense and captivating experience that sets crash aviator apart from traditional casino games.
The core gameplay loop revolves around predicting when the multiplier will reach a satisfying level, balancing the desire for a large win against the inherent probability of the plane crashing. Many games also allow players to auto-cashout at a specific multiplier, providing a safety net and minimizing the risk of losing their stake. Understanding these basic mechanics is crucial for anyone looking to participate effectively and strategically.

Understanding the Role of Random Number Generators (RNGs)
Crash aviator games, like all online casino games, rely on Random Number Generators (RNGs) to ensure fairness and randomness. RNGs are sophisticated algorithms that produce unpredictable sequences of numbers, determining the crash point of the plane. Reputable game providers utilize certified RNGs that are regularly audited by independent testing agencies to verify their integrity. Understanding the role of RNGs is crucial for dispelling the misconception that patterns or strategies can consistently predict the outcome of each round. While observing trends might be tempting, the underlying mechanism is inherently random.
While you can’t predict random events, knowledge of how RNG’s operate does help manage expectations. Knowing that each round is independent of previous ones prevents the gambler’s fallacy—the belief that past results influence future outcomes. Players should only rely on sound bankroll management and strategic betting approaches, rather than attempting to decipher nonexistent patterns in the RNG output.

The Psychological Aspects of Playing Crash Aviator
Playing crash aviator, like any form of gambling, can evoke a range of emotions, including excitement, anticipation, and even frustration. Being aware of these psychological factors is essential for maintaining a rational and disciplined approach. Avoid making impulsive decisions based on emotional responses, such as chasing losses or becoming overconfident after a series of wins. Recognize the signs of problem gambling, such as spending more time and money than intended, lying about your gambling activities, or experiencing negative consequences in your personal or professional life.
If you’re struggling with gambling issues, seek help from a qualified professional or support organization. Resources are available to provide guidance, counseling, and support. Remember, responsible gaming is paramount. Set limits, stick to your budget, and prioritize your well-being. It is also important to be aware of the “near miss” phenomenon, where almost winning can be more frustrating than losing outright.
